Home
last modified time | relevance | path

Searched refs:esp_timer_handle_t (Results 1 – 15 of 15) sorted by relevance

/hal_espressif-latest/components/esp_timer/include/
Desp_timer.h47 typedef struct esp_timer* esp_timer_handle_t; typedef
142 esp_timer_handle_t* out_handle);
156 esp_err_t esp_timer_start_once(esp_timer_handle_t timer, uint64_t timeout_us);
171 esp_err_t esp_timer_start_periodic(esp_timer_handle_t timer, uint64_t period);
187 esp_err_t esp_timer_restart(esp_timer_handle_t timer, uint64_t timeout_us);
200 esp_err_t esp_timer_stop(esp_timer_handle_t timer);
213 esp_err_t esp_timer_delete(esp_timer_handle_t timer);
249 esp_err_t esp_timer_get_period(esp_timer_handle_t timer, uint64_t *period);
266 esp_err_t esp_timer_get_expiry_time(esp_timer_handle_t timer, uint64_t *expiry);
318 bool esp_timer_is_active(esp_timer_handle_t timer);
/hal_espressif-latest/components/esp_timer/src/
Desp_timer.c95 static esp_err_t timer_insert(esp_timer_handle_t timer, bool without_update_alarm);
96 static esp_err_t timer_remove(esp_timer_handle_t timer);
97 static bool timer_armed(esp_timer_handle_t timer);
102 static void timer_insert_inactive(esp_timer_handle_t timer);
103 static void timer_remove_inactive(esp_timer_handle_t timer);
136 esp_timer_handle_t* out_handle) in esp_timer_create()
145 esp_timer_handle_t result = (esp_timer_handle_t) k_calloc(1, sizeof(*result)); in esp_timer_create()
170 esp_err_t IRAM_ATTR esp_timer_restart(esp_timer_handle_t timer, uint64_t timeout_us) in esp_timer_restart()
220 esp_err_t IRAM_ATTR esp_timer_start_once(esp_timer_handle_t timer, uint64_t timeout_us) in esp_timer_start_once()
254 esp_err_t IRAM_ATTR esp_timer_start_periodic(esp_timer_handle_t timer, uint64_t period_us) in esp_timer_start_periodic()
[all …]
Dets_timer_legacy.c39 #define ESP_TIMER(p_ets_timer) ((esp_timer_handle_t) (p_ets_timer)->timer_arg)
67 … ESP_ERROR_CHECK( esp_timer_create(&create_args, (esp_timer_handle_t*)&(ptimer->timer_arg)) ); in ets_timer_setfn()
/hal_espressif-latest/components/esp_phy/src/
Dphy_common.c22 static esp_timer_handle_t phy_track_pll_timer;
/hal_espressif-latest/components/bt/porting/npl/freertos/include/nimble/
Dnpl_freertos.h47 esp_timer_handle_t handle;
/hal_espressif-latest/components/esp_system/task_wdt/
Dtask_wdt_impl_esp_timer.c24 esp_timer_handle_t sw_timer;
/hal_espressif-latest/components/bt/esp_ble_mesh/mesh_common/
Dmesh_timer.c24 esp_timer_handle_t alarm_hdl;
/hal_espressif-latest/components/esp_system/port/
Dusb_console.c69 static esp_timer_handle_t s_restart_timer;
/hal_espressif-latest/components/bt/common/osi/
Dalarm.c32 esp_timer_handle_t alarm_hdl;
/hal_espressif-latest/components/bt/porting/npl/freertos/src/
Dnpl_os_freertos.c853 err = esp_timer_get_expiry_time((esp_timer_handle_t)(callout->handle), &expiry); in npl_freertos_callout_get_ticks()
893 err = esp_timer_get_expiry_time((esp_timer_handle_t)(callout->handle), &expiry); in npl_freertos_callout_remaining_ticks()
/hal_espressif-latest/components/driver/touch_sensor/esp32/
Dtouch_sensor.c35 esp_timer_handle_t timer;
/hal_espressif-latest/zephyr/esp32c3/src/bt/
Desp_bt_adapter.c376 static DRAM_ATTR esp_timer_handle_t s_btdm_slp_tmr;
/hal_espressif-latest/zephyr/esp32s3/src/bt/
Desp_bt_adapter.c374 static DRAM_ATTR esp_timer_handle_t s_btdm_slp_tmr;
/hal_espressif-latest/components/bt/controller/esp32c3/
Dbt.c431 static DRAM_ATTR esp_timer_handle_t s_btdm_slp_tmr = NULL;
/hal_espressif-latest/components/bt/controller/esp32/
Dbt.c454 static DRAM_ATTR esp_timer_handle_t s_btdm_slp_tmr;